Chronic inflammation is one of the most overlooked root causes of midlife and menopause symptoms. It can drive bloating, fatigue, mood swings, skin flare-ups, joint pain, and even burnout—even when you’re doing “everything right.”
In this episode of It’s Not Just Menopause, Cindi Stickle, Functional Nutrition Practitioner and Certified Menopause Specialist, breaks down how inflammation impacts your hormones, gut, and nervous system—and what you can actually do about it.
What You’ll Learn🔥 What inflammation really is—and why it ramps up in midlife 🩺 The subtle signs of chronic inflammation (even if your labs look “normal”) ⚖️ How blood sugar swings, toxins, gut health, and stress all connect to inflammation 🌱 Simple, sustainable shifts to reduce inflammation without a major overhaul 💡 Why nervous system support is the missing piece for long-term hormone relief
